Sesquiterpenoids from the rhizomes of Atractylodes macrocephala and their protection against lipopolysaccharide-induced neuroinflammation in microglia BV-2 cells
The rhizomes of Atractylodes macrocephala have been widely used in both functional foods and herbal medicines for a long history.
